By Richa Naidu

LONDON, (Reuters) – Nestle SA will fly baby formula products to the United States via the Netherlands and Switzerland in order to relieve the current shortage at U.S. grocery stores, it said Tuesday.

Nestle said that it is moving Gerber baby foods formula from the Netherlands to the United States and Alfamino formula from Switzerland from Switzerland to America, in an emailed statement sent to Reuters.

The company stated that they prioritized the products “because they serve a crucial medical purpose, as they are for baby’s with cow milk protein allergy.” Both products had been imported, but we moved the shipments to make it possible for us to rush via air and meet immediate demand.

Since the top U.S. baby formula manufacturer, panicked parents have emptied U.S. supermarket shelves of baby formula. Abbott Laboratories (NYSE:) In February, dozens of Similac and Alimentum formulas were recalled by the company.

Reckitt Benckiser has increased its production of baby formula by around 30% and is making frequent deliveries to retailers to address a nationwide shortage, Reuters was told Tuesday by an executive.
